MATHEMATICAL MODELING OF THERMOPHYSICAL PROCESSES IN THERMOELECTRIC DEVICES FOR SEAWATER DESALINATION

The article considers the mathematical modeling of thermal processes of phase transition «water-ice» to reflect the changes on the boundary of the impurity concentration, typical for fresh water by the method of freezing sea.
